Police investigating the armed robbery of a Keperra convenience store earlier this month have released images of a man who may be able to assist with their investigation.
On November 10 a man entered theGilston Streetshop at about 5.15pm and threatened a shop assistant with a small knife before demanding he hand over cash.
The man stole money from the cash register and was last seen getting into a silver Ford Falcon utility (similar to that pictured) which drove off towards Samford Road.
The silver Ford Falcon utility was sighted parked at the intersection of Gilston Street and Cramption Road, Keperra during the robbery.
The man is described as being Caucasian in appearance, aged in his early 20s, about 175cm tall with a tanned complexion and brown eyes.
He was wearing a black hooded top with a white emblem on the front, a white checked bandana, dark blue shorts with a white stripe down the sides, white runners and a bum bag worn at the front.
